Srinagar: Senior Hurriyat (separatist) leader Prof. Abdul Gani Bhat was summoned by the JIC (Joint Interrogation center) Jammu and questioned by the State Investigation Agency (SIA) for nearly 8 hours in a militancy, Hawala funding case on Saturday.ย
A top official said that Mr. Bhat was summoned related to a case of militancy and Hawala funding in which former minister Jitendra Singh alias Babu Singh was earlier arrested.ย ย
ย
He said Bhat was questioned for nearly eight hours till evening at JIC Jammu after he was summoned by the agency today.
ย
"During questioning Bhat revealed many facts regarding the money received from across the border by different Hurriyat leaders in the Valley," KNO quoted an unknown official saying.ย
ย
Prof. Bhat heads Jammu and Kashmir Muslim Conference and in the past, he had been the head of the Hurriyat Conference.ย
ย
Born in Botengo village of Sopore in North Kashmir, Bhat studied Persian, Economics, and Political Science at Sri Pratap College in Srinagar and then pursued his post-graduation in Persian and Law at Aligarh Muslim University.ย
